Chris (Tulsa, OK)
Second Set
This my second set of these tires for my Star Roadliner and I have no complaints only compliments. The OEM's on my bike were Dunlop which performed well but were lacking in tread life (around 8500 miles) and that was with taking all the measures to reduce tread wear. I cut these tires no slack and get 10,000 miles from the rear tire and 12,000 out of the front. Thanks Motorcycle-Superstore for supplying great tires at a great price.

B C. (St. Petersburg,, FL)
OK tire for price
Bike: 1998 Honda VT1100CT - New Metzler ME880 on rear - Bridgestone Exedra G851 Front Tire - Had 1 month (wet traction and tread life NA). I went from a Metzler ME880 front tire to save a few bucks. I am not of the opinion that this tire is as good as the previous Metzler front tire but I have only had it for a month but it has seemingly gotten better with some wear. Initially, I am getting more road feedback (bumps and other jerk motions) that I did not notice before with the Metzler but this seems to be getting less as the tire wears. Since buying this, I see that Bridgestone has come out with a newer version of this tire it may be better than the one I purchased. I notice that hard mid-speed cornering, with the change in the tread from the center of the tire toward the sidewall that you notice the transition with the tread style and it feels weird. The dry traction has been good and breaking has improved over the old Metzler (but that was 2+ year old rubber). However I not convinced. I guess sometime I am going to find out what it is like in the rain, I hope that the center grove will effectively spit the water out. At this point, I am not going to buy it again but it just may need more breaking in time.
